Funny, smart, mysterious, and cute — this irresistible graphic novel keeps young readers turning pages nonstop. 


Rosa is a crabby old lady living alone on the edge of the forest. One evening, a three-legged stray dog wanders into her life. Rosa would love nothing more than to send him away—but the dog’s persistence and surprising cleverness soon prove useful. With his extraordinary sense of smell, the dog may be the key to uncovering the truth behind a village mystery that has remained unsolved for over thirty years. 

As the unlikely duo investigates the past, readers are drawn into a story filled with warmth, gentle suspense, and an unexpected friendship! 

After the international success of My Trip with Drip, talented German artist Josephine Mark returns with a heartwarming and entertaining graphic novel that blends mystery and suspense with quirky characters and gentle humor — a delight for everyone who loves a good story. Perfect for fans of Courage the Cowardly Dog.

Josephine Mark, born in 1981 in Naumburg/Saale, works as an illustrator, comic artist and graphic designer. She has been publishing comics and cartoons since 2004. Her book My Trip with Drip was nominated for the German Children's Book Prize and won the Max and Moritz Award for best graphic novel. Her own experience being treated for cancer was the inspiration for My Trip with Drip. She lives in Leipzig, Germany.
